acetylsalicylate

American  
[uh-seet-l-suh-lis-uh-leyt, uh-set-, as-i-tl-] / əˌsit l səˈlɪs əˌleɪt, əˌsɛt-, ˌæs ɪ tl- /

noun

Pharmacology.
  1. a salt or ester of acetylsalicylic acid.


Etymology

Origin of acetylsalicylate

First recorded in 1955–60; acetylsalicyl(ic acid) + -ate 2
